Official: WWE WrestleMania XXX Goes To Mercedes-Benz Superdome Next Year

The epic event of WWE called Wrestlemania 29 is coming this Sunday, April 7 at the MetLife Stadium in East Rutherford, New Jersey. The event is considered by wrestling fans as their very own Super Bowl and this is also viewed as a season-ender of the regular TV programming of the company. Following the success of the Super Bowl this year at the Mercedes-Benz Superdome, the rumors about WWE booking their next major event in that same location has finally been confirmed. Mercedes-Benz Superdome Looking to Host a Major WWE Spectacle in 2014

This year, the Mercedes-Benz Superdome in New Orleans, Louisiana hosted the Super Bowl in what is considered to be a huge win and win situation for the famous automobile company. This is because they were able to showcase the brand in different media and they were able to gain the much needed exposure for their products. Based on sports news insiders, the Mercedes-Benz branded stadium is looking to host another spectacle next year and that is WWE’s 30th Wrestlemania. The Wrestlemania is an annual sports entertainment event produced by WWE or World Wrestling Entertainment, Inc. Mercedes-Benz — The Obvious Winner in the Super Bowl

Based on a report by Forbes, one of America’s top financial publications, the obvious winner in the 2013 Super Bowl is the Mercedes-Benz brand. This is because the company has its logo and name almost all over the exterior of the structure, especially if you are looking at the aerial view of the Mercedes-Benz Superdome. So, it is almost impossible to miss the name of the German automobile manufacturer when you are shooting video from the outside. The Superdome was also continuously referenced by the media covering the event by its official name.
